            Originally posted by noonan2112
            Thanks again for posting this list. I was wondering if maybe I did something wrong though. After adding back every single one of the players for each team, there were a couple instances when it told me the 40 man roster was already full even though I still had a couple people from your list to add.

            After doing this, I also noticed there were a few of the "injured" players not at the MLB level and still in Single A from Owl's roster set. I added them to the 40 and moved them to MLB. I then placed the proper ones on the DL.

            Once I started a couple games, there was an automated message that nearly every team had gone over their max limit of players/roster size. I auto-fixed them all out of frustration and imagine that almost every lineup is all messed up again.

            Luckily I still have the master save file before I did any of the injury stuff. Any tips???
            I think what's happening is one of two things.
            60 day DL players don't count towards the 40 man....if you added everyone..you'd go over the 40 when he came back.(IRL....teams are over 40 due to this...I had to pick some guys to leave off on my own)
            The second is like above...except too many guys at the MLB level due to DL'ed guys coming back and getting put on the MLB.
            Same as above.
            If you AUTO-FIX anything....it will fix it alright.

                      Originally posted by haiuguyz
                      Just bringing up my previous question: does anyone know how to stop so many players from progressing so fast?

                      GREAT rosters, but just like every roster out there, 4 years from now there's like 50-60 "99 overall" players...
                      The next patch has some progression aspects fixes to it which hopefully will fix or curtail this issue. You could also swap/remove some A/B potential players with C/D ratings so the overall pool of talent is less. In addition, you could just lower the current ratings of some players.

                        Originally posted by haiuguyz
                        Just bringing up my previous question: does anyone know how to stop so many players from progressing so fast?

                        GREAT rosters, but just like every roster out there, 4 years from now there's like 50-60 "99 overall" players...
                        I'm guessing you have Training on Manual. Players progress crazy fast when you do that. Put it on Auto and they won't develop as fast.
